Overview of the Story

The story of The Old Man and the Sea is about an aging fisherman named Santiago, who embarks on a journey to catch a giant marlin, available as a pdf file online. The novel tells the tale of Santiago’s perseverance and determination as he faces various challenges during his journey. The story is a classic tale of man versus nature, with Santiago’s struggle against the giant marlin being a symbol of his own struggle against the forces of nature. Main Character Analysis

The main character, Santiago, is a complex and intriguing figure, as seen in the pdf version of the book. He is an old fisherman who has gone 84 days without catching a fish, and his journey is one of perseverance and determination. Through his character, Hemingway explores themes of courage, pride, and the human struggle against nature. Santiago’s relationship with the sea and its creatures is also a significant aspect of his character, and is deeply explored in the pdf version of the novel, which is available online for readers to access and analyze. Symbolic Interpretation

The Old Man and the Sea pdf offers a rich symbolic interpretation, with the old man representing perseverance and the sea symbolizing life’s challenges and mysteries. The marlin, a symbol of pride and achievement, is a notable example of Hemingway’s use of symbolism to convey themes and ideas. The shark, on the other hand, represents the destructive forces of nature and the inevitability of defeat. Awards and Recognition

The Old Man and the Sea received the Pulitzer Prize for Fiction in 1953, a prestigious award for pdf and print publications.
